PHYLUM: ANIMAL
CLASS: AQUATIC
Animals of the aquatic class are nearly always superb swimmers and most can onlu breathe underwater; however, there are a few exceptions, such as dolphins and whales, which breathe air, but are able to hold their breath for long periods of time measure into hours at times. Most of the aquatic class lay eggs, but a few give live birth.

Bregdi

Zoola Animal Aquatic
A malicious sea monster, the Bregdi is feared for its habit of chasing boats. Once it has caught up with a boat, it wraps its long fins around it, putting them up over the gunwales, and dives with the boat in its deadly embrace. The entire act requires only a minute (5 rounds) to sink even a galleon. Fortunately a bregdi’s attentions can be deterred in two ways. The bregdi hates the touch of cold steel. A simple steel (not iron) dagger is more than enough to combat it. Slashing the fins as soon as they appear over the gunwales will make it let go and flee. It is also terrified of amber beads, and a single amber bead thrown at a bregdi is enough to scare it off.

Manta Ray

Zoola Animal Aquatic
Manta Rays are cartilaginous fish with triangular pectoral fins, horn-shaped cephalic fins and large, forward-facing mouths. They tend to be gentle and often flee from any predator. If startled, one can attack with its barbed, non-toxic tail.
Octopus

Zoola Animal Aquatic
A medium-sized aquatic creature that gains +2 to grappling and may grab up to 2 creatures within 5 feet within the same round. If establishing a hold until its next turn, the octopus can bite the opponent with a +4 bonus to hit, and that bite will deliver a corrosive poison that inflicts d3 points of damage if the victim fails a Resilience save (DC:9). Moreover, it can, once per encounter, release a 5-foot-radius cloud of ink which extends all around the octopus if it is underwater. The area is heavily obscured for 1 minute, although a significant current can disperse the ink. After releasing the ink, the octopus can use perform a dash action simultaneously to the release.
Giant Octopus

Zoola Animal Aquatic
Enormous aquatic creature with ten-to-fifteen-foot tentacles. It gains +6 to grappling and may grab up to 4 creatures within 15 feet. Otherwise, it can bludgeon with its tentacles and may split 4d20 dice as desired. However, it can, once per encounter, release a 20-foot-radius cloud of ink what extends all around the octopus if it is underwater. The area is heavily obscured for 1 minute, although a significant current can disperse the ink. After releasing the ink, the octopus can use perform a dash action simultaneously to the release.
